Another article on this economic mess: How did it all happen?

As I write this, the dow is down 430 points, below 10,000 for the first time in four years. Tyler Cowen has published his list of what went wrong, with which I largely concur. Another way to think about it is as a series of cognitive errors that afflicted everyone: investors, home buyers, lenders, regulators. They're standard cognitive errors that so far, no one has a very good way of eradicating:

The list is pretty interesting....

Optimistic bias: People tend to be overconfident about their own abilities and the outcome of their plans. Something like 90% of people think that they are above average drivers less likely to get into an accident than the average joe. This is so pervasive that there is actually a scientific name for the few people who accurately assess their own future, their abilities, and what other people think of them: clinically depressed.

Heh. A while back there was a study that suggested that depressed people have a more accurate view of the probabilities of success and failure in any given venture, but recently there's been some doubt cast upon that result....
